The Genetics of Red Hair
Red hair is not a single gene trait, but rather a complex interplay of genetics, primarily linked to the MC1R gene (Melanocortin 1 Receptor). This gene plays a crucial role in determining the type and amount of melanin produced in the body. Melanin is the pigment responsible for hair, skin, and eye colour. There are two main types of melanin: eumelanin (which produces black and brown shades) and pheomelanin (which produces red and yellow shades).
Individuals with red hair typically have two copies of a mutated version of the MC1R gene. This mutation leads to a higher production of pheomelanin and a lower production of eumelanin. The specific variations in the MC1R gene can result in a spectrum of red hair colours, from a deep auburn to a vibrant, almost orange hue.
It's important to note that red hair is a recessive trait. This means that both parents must carry at least one copy of the mutated MC1R gene for their child to have red hair. Interestingly, both parents can have brown or black hair and still have a red-haired child if they are both carriers of the gene.
Prevalence of Red Hair
Red hair is the rarest natural hair colour in humans, occurring in approximately 1-2% of the world's population. It is most common in people of Northern or Western European descent, particularly in Ireland and Scotland, where the prevalence can be as high as 10-13%. The genetic mutations associated with red hair are thought to have originated in Central Asia thousands of years ago before spreading through migration.
Myths and Stereotypes Surrounding Redheads
Throughout history, red hair has been associated with a variety of, often contradictory, stereotypes. These range from the belief that redheads have fiery tempers and are more prone to anger, to notions of them being more passionate, alluring, or even mischievous. Let's examine some common myths:
Myth 1: Redheads have fiery tempers.
This is perhaps one of the most enduring stereotypes. While anecdotal evidence might suggest a correlation, scientific studies have not found a direct link between red hair and aggressive behaviour or a predisposition to anger. The perception likely stems from historical associations and cultural portrayals in literature and media, where fiery-haired characters are often depicted as passionate or volatile.
Myth 2: Redheads feel less pain.
There is some scientific basis to the idea that redheads may have a different pain threshold, but it's not necessarily that they feel *less* pain. Research suggests that the MC1R gene, which influences hair colour, also plays a role in pain perception and the body's response to anaesthesia. Some studies indicate that redheads might be more sensitive to certain types of pain, such as thermal pain, while potentially requiring lower doses of certain anaesthetics. However, the exact mechanisms are still being investigated, and the idea that they feel significantly less pain is largely a simplification.
Myth 3: Redheads are more likely to be left-handed.
This is another popular, though largely unsubstantiated, myth. While some studies have explored potential links between hair colour and handedness, the evidence is inconclusive and often contradictory. The prevalence of left-handedness is generally around 10% of the population, and there isn't a strong, consistent correlation with red hair.
Myth 4: Red hair is a sign of a bad omen or witchcraft.
Historically, in some cultures, red hair was viewed with suspicion and associated with negative attributes, including witchcraft and devilry. This likely stemmed from the rarity of the trait and its association with the colour red, which itself has a complex symbolism, often linked to passion, danger, and the devil. Thankfully, these superstitious beliefs have largely faded in modern society.
The Unique Characteristics of Red Hair
Beyond the myths, red hair does come with some distinct characteristics:
- Sensitivity to Sunlight: People with red hair often have fairer skin that burns more easily in the sun. This is because the MC1R gene affects melanin production, leading to less protection from UV radiation. It's crucial for redheads to practice sun safety, including wearing sunscreen, protective clothing, and hats.
- Higher Vitamin D Production: Conversely, the same genetic makeup that makes redheads more susceptible to sunburn may also enable them to produce vitamin D more efficiently from sunlight. This is because their bodies need less UV radiation to stimulate vitamin D synthesis.
- Unique Hair Texture: Red hair is often described as being thicker and coarser than other hair colours, although the actual hair shaft diameter might not be significantly different. It's more about the density and how the hair strands group together.
Red Hair in Different Cultures
The perception and treatment of redheads vary significantly across different cultures and historical periods. While in some parts of Europe, red hair was once associated with negative connotations, in others, it was admired. For instance:
- Ancient Rome: Red hair was seen as exotic and desirable, with red wigs being fashionable.
- Medieval Europe: The association with witchcraft and the devil was more prevalent, leading to persecution in some areas.
- Modern Western Cultures: Today, red hair is often celebrated as unique and beautiful. Campaigns and social media movements have emerged to promote pride in red hair and challenge negative stereotypes.

Q1: Is red hair going to disappear?
A1: While red hair is rare, it is unlikely to disappear entirely. The genes for red hair are recessive, meaning they can be carried by individuals with other hair colours. As long as people carrying these genes continue to reproduce, red hair will persist in the population, albeit at low frequencies.
Q2: Can people of all ethnicities have red hair?
A2: While red hair is most common in people of European descent, the MC1R gene mutation can occur in individuals of any ethnicity. However, it is far less common in populations with predominantly darker skin tones due to the different evolutionary pressures and genetic variations related to melanin production.
